Simple and Exponential Moving Averages (SMA & EMA)
Moving averages smooth out price data to reveal underlying trends. Here's a snapshot of current key levels:
- 50-Day SMA: $0.001983 — Currently below market price, suggesting short-term bullish momentum.
- 200-Day SMA: $0.002982 — Above current price, acting as a strong resistance level.
When the price trades above the 50-day SMA but below the 200-day SMA, it often indicates a short-term uptrend within a longer-term consolidation phase. A breakout above the 200-day SMA could signal renewed bullish momentum.

Relative Strength Index (RSI) – Overbought Conditions
The 14-day RSI stands at 73.54, placing OXY in overbought territory (above 70). Historically, RSI readings above 70 suggest that an asset may be overvalued and due for a pullback unless strong buying pressure persists.
While overbought conditions don’t guarantee a price drop, they do increase the likelihood of consolidation or correction—especially when paired with high greed sentiment.

What Influences Oxygen’s Price?
Several factors drive OXY’s value:
- Solana Network Performance: As an SPL token, OXY’s success is tied to Solana’s scalability, speed, and developer activity.
- DeFi Adoption: Increased use of Oxygen’s decentralized exchange and lending features can boost demand.
- Market Sentiment & Macro Trends: Broader crypto bull runs often lift smaller caps temporarily.
- Whale Activity: Large holders can significantly influence price due to lower liquidity.
- Regulatory Developments: Changes in crypto policy may impact investor confidence.
Understanding these forces helps separate hype from sustainable growth potential.

How accurate are long-term crypto price predictions?
Long-term forecasts are inherently speculative. While models use historical data and technical patterns, unforeseen events—such as regulatory shifts or tech breakthroughs—can drastically alter trajectories. Always treat predictions as guidance, not guarantees.
